  • Recycle Bins in Kaimuki Area
    Some schools in the Kaimuki area have set up Community Recycling Bins that you can help support. Each month, these participating schools receive a check from City Department of Environmental Services for the recyclable materials collected in their bins. By taking your recyclables (aluminum cans, glass bottles & jars, plastic containers, newspapers, cardboard, etc) to these Recycling Bins, you also help support the school's fundraising efforts.
  • Redemption Centers In Kaimuki Area
    Redemption Centers accept various recyclables like beverage containers, waste paper, cardboard, ferrous and non-ferrous scrap metal, appliances, and plastic. Going to these centers not only help our efforts in going green, you also get some of your money back for recycling.

What is Going Green?

Simply put, going green means to pursue a lifestyle that is environment-friendly. The goal is to help protect the environment and sustain its natural resources for current and future generations to come.

Ongoing - Fundraiser - Recycle Your Old Eyeglasses
EyeSight Hawaii and Dr. Olkowski are partnered with the Lions Club Foundation to collect used eyeglasses and distribute them to people in need throughout the world.
